Embracing the Role of the Generalist: A Versatile Approach to Professional Success

In today’s world, characterized by rapid advancements and an ever-evolving economic landscape, the archetype of the generalist has gained unprecedented relevance. Unlike their specialized counterparts, generalists possess a vast expanse of knowledge across various fields, enabling them to adapt, innovate, and thrive in multifaceted environments. This ability to wear multiple hats and draw connections between disparate domains becomes increasingly vital as organizations strive for efficiency and adaptability.

At the heart of the generalist’s skill set lies a profound understanding of diverse disciplines. Generalists are not merely jack-of-all-trades; they are adept learners, capable of assimilating information from an array of sectors—be it technology, management, design, or operations. This eclectic expertise empowers them to take a holistic view of challenges and opportunities, facilitating integrative solutions that specialists might overlook. Such versatility fosters agile decision-making, equipping businesses to navigate the complexities of the modern marketplace.

Another salient characteristic of effective generalists is their proficiency in communication. Being well-rounded endows them with the capacity to converse fluently across various arenas, whether engaging with engineers, marketers, or financial analysts. This cross-functional dialogue cultivates an environment of collaboration, where ideas can flourish uninhibited by disciplinary silos. In essence, generalists serve as the connective tissue within organizations, fostering teamwork and innovation through their exceptional ability to distill complex concepts into accessible language.

Moreover, generalists thrive in roles that demand project management and oversight. They possess a panoramic perspective that allows them to orchestrate diverse tasks and facilitate cohesive progress toward organizational goals. By recognizing the interdependencies between various elements of a project, they can manage resources more effectively, optimize workflows, and mitigate risks that might derail a narrower-focused team. The increasing complexity of global markets necessitates a workforce well-versed in agility and adaptability. Generalists embody these traits, often possessing a keen ability to pivot when faced with uncertainty, thus ensuring their organizations remain resilient in the face of change. Their proclivity for resourcefulness allows them to approach problems with a fresh perspective, which often results in the unearthing of innovative solutions that might otherwise remain buried under conventional methodologies.

In addition to their tactical advantages, generalists are masters of networking. Their broad interests and adaptable nature enable them to foster relationships across a myriad of sectors, enriching their professional circle. This interconnected web can be a precious asset, opening doors to collaborations, partnerships, and new ventures that may not be accessible to specialists. By leveraging their networks, generalists can tap into a wealth of resources, insights, and opportunities, reinforcing their value within any given endeavor.

It is also worth noting that as the workforce becomes increasingly digitized, the demand for generalists is expected to rise. With industries converging and traditional roles dissipating, having a multidisciplinary approach can provide a competitive edge. Organizations are recognizing the importance of cognitive flexibility; the capacity to switch between tasks and apply diverse skills to solve problems will be paramount in the future job market.

In conclusion, the role of the generalist is not only relevant but essential in our contemporary professional landscape. Their unique combination of adaptability, effective communication, and integrative thinking equips them to handle the multifarious challenges faced by organizations today. As we venture further into an era marked by complexity and interconnectivity, embracing the generalist approach will undoubtedly pave the way for enhanced innovation and success across industries. Regardless of the sector, cultivating a culture that appreciates the value of a versatile workforce will be instrumental in achieving sustainable growth and excellence.
